sum of digits of a two digit number is 9. when the digits are interchanged ,the new number is greater than the original number by 9. find the original number.

To Find :

  • We have to find the original number .

Solution :

Let units place digit be y and ten's place digit be x.

Sum of digits of two digit number is 9.

  • x + y = 9
  • x = 9 - y ...1)

Number formed : 10x + y

when the digits are interchanged ,the new number is greater than the original number by 9.

Reversed number : 10y + x

10x + y + 9 = 10y + x

10x - x + y - 10y = -9

9x - 9y = -9

9y - 9x = 9

  • Substituting value of x from Equation (1)

9y -9(9 - y) = 9

9y - 81 + 9y = 9

18y = 9 + 81

18y = 90

y = 90/18

y = 5

  • Substituting value of y in equation (1)

x = 9 - y

x = 9 - 5

x = 4

So,

Original number 10x + y :

= 10 × 4 + 5

= 45
